Chapter 2. Functional Description
The following is a functional description of the LN-CSAC.
2.1 PRINCIPLE OF OPERATION
The LN-CSAC is a passive atomic clock, incorporating the interrogation technique of
coherent population trapping (CPT) and operating on the D1 optical resonance of
atomic cesium. A complete description of passive atomic clocks, CPT, and the
LN-CSAC architecture is beyond the scope of this user’s guide. The following illustra-
tion shows a simplified block diagram of the LN-CSAC.
FIGURE 2-1: Simplified LN-CSAC Block Diagram.
The principal RF output from the LN-CSAC is provided by an evacuated miniature crys-
tal oscillator (EMXO). In normal operation, the frequency of the EMXO is continuously
compared and corrected to the ground state hyperfine frequency of the cesium atoms,
contained within the physics package, which thereby improves the long-term stability
and environmental sensitivity of the EMXO. In addition to the EMXO and the physics
package (Note 1), the essential components of the LN-CSAC are the microwave syn-
thesizer and the microprocessor (Note 2). The microwave synthesizer generates
4596.3 MHz with tuning resolution of approximately 1 × 10
–12
. The microprocessor
serves multiple functions, including implementation of the frequency-lock loop filter for
the EMXO, optimization of physics package operation, state-of-health monitoring, and
command and control through the serial communications port.
